Detailed Solution

During process A to B, pressure and volume both are decreasing. Therefore, temperature and, hence, internal energy of the gas will decrease (T∝PV) or ΔUA→B negative. Further ΔWA→B is also negative as the volume of the gas is decreasing. Thus, ΔQA→B is negative.In process B to C, pressure of the gas is constant while volume is increasing. Hence, temperature should increase or ΔUB→C=positive. During C to A, volume is constant while pressure is increasing. Therefore, temperature and hence, internal energy of the gas should increase or ΔUC→A= positive. During process CAB, volume of the gas is decreasing. Hence, work done by the gas is negative.
